School overview

Springfield Junior School is a primary school serving Swadlincote, Derbyshire, classified by the DfE as an academy sponsor led. It has 200 pupils aged 7 to 11 on roll. At its most recent graded inspection, Ofsted rated Springfield Junior School 'Good'. 32% of its pupils met the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at the end of Key Stage 2, well below the national average (national figure: 61%). The proportion reaching the expected standard has fallen by 5.0 percentage points compared with the previous year. On our composite score, which combines the DfE attainment measures above, this places it in the lower half of primary schools nationally.

Pupils achieved an average scaled score of 100 in reading and 99 in maths (national averages are about 105 and 104). 2% reached the higher standard across all three subjects (around 8% do so nationally). The school serves a community with above-average levels of disadvantage: about 64% of pupils have been eligible for free school meals in the last six years, compared with roughly 24% nationally — useful context when reading the results above.
